What We're All About
We began Kosher Connection, Inc., formerly Creative
Cuisine, almost 19 years ago after having worked for
several other Kansas City caterers.  We realized that we
had what it took to understand our client's needs and
work with them, using our culinary expertise, to plan
fantastic events.  We started small, and soon after we
were catering parties for hundreds of people.  Because
kosher catering became our signature, in 1995 we
changed our name to Kosher Connection, Inc., and have
been doing predominantly kosher events ever since!  We
make all the traditional Jewish favorites, from matzo-ball
soup to noodle kugel, and we pride ourselves on doing
our own baking using the finest ingredients.

While a party of 1,000 guests for Country Hill Bank;s 10th
anniversary remains our largest party so far, our average
event is typically several hundred people.  When it
comes to the type of food that our clients want for their
events, we work with them to develop a menu that is
personal to them that will fit within their budget.  We
often work with families who may have a special family
recipe that they'd like at their event and incorporate it
into our menu.  We've even had grandmothers in the
kitchen teaching us how to cook their secret family
recipes!
